无障碍设计漏洞速查与索引优化指南
|
无障碍设计的核心在于确保所有用户,包括视障、听障、行动不便或认知障碍者,都能顺畅使用数字产品。然而,许多系统在实际部署中仍存在未被察觉的漏洞,影响用户体验。常见的问题如缺少替代文本、表单标签缺失、键盘导航断点、颜色对比度不足等,均可能使部分用户无法正常操作。 视觉内容若无替代文本(alt text),屏幕阅读器将无法传达图像信息,导致视障用户失去关键上下文。建议为每张图片添加简洁准确的描述,避免“图片”“图示”等无效提示。同时,动态内容更新时应通过ARIA属性通知辅助技术,防止信息遗漏。 表单设计中的常见错误包括缺乏显式标签、错误的输入类型设置以及错误提示不清晰。每个输入字段都应绑定``元素,且错误提示需与字段关联,使用`aria-invalid`和`aria-describedby`明确状态。确保所有交互元素均可通过键盘访问,且焦点顺序符合逻辑。 颜色对比度是另一大隐患。文字与背景之间的对比度应至少达到4.5:1(正常文本)或3:1(大字号)。可借助工具如WebAIM Contrast Checker快速检测。避免仅依赖颜色传递信息,例如用图标+文字双重标识成功或警告状态。 索引优化虽非直接无障碍功能,却显著提升内容可访问性。合理使用语义化标签(如``、``、``)有助于屏幕阅读器理解页面结构。通过``至``建立清晰的标题层级,帮助用户快速定位内容。避免跳过标题级别或重复使用同一标题。
AI模拟图,仅供参考 定期进行自动化测试(如axe、Lighthouse)并结合人工评审,能有效发现潜在缺陷。团队应建立无障碍检查清单,覆盖重点场景,如登录流程、搜索功能、多语言支持等。持续迭代优于一次性修复,真正实现包容性设计。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

